During labor, a typical fetal heart rate can span from 110 to 160 beats per minute, although brief variations outside this range can occur for a variety of (often perfectly normal) reasons. The detection of a fetal heart beat is normally only possible from about 22 days of gestation, so, if the heartbeat can be seen, you know that the kitten must have a fetal age of at least 3 weeks and that it is, for now, a living, presumably-viable kitten.
